The Class 317 electric multiple unit is a well proven 4-car unit that has run on the UK rail network since 1981.

The class has been well maintained, and seen various refurbishments and improvements through its service life including full overhaul to a new condition every 5 to 7 years.

The Class 317 is based on the BR Mk 3 coaching stock design, known for its smooth high-speed running. Passenger accommodation may vary by operator, with some mixed 1st / 2nd class and other units all 2nd class.

Vehicles are connected by a flexible diaphragm, are air conditioned, have wheelchair seating areas and public address and information display systems.

Standard gauge, and capable of running on any 25 kV 50 Hz AC overhead electrified network with the appropriate clearance.

Detailed Specification

Class: 317 Operator: Various UK Type: Multiple Unit - EMU Usage: Outer-urban Number of cars: 4 Transmission: Electric Wheel arrangement: Bogie Specification: UK Maximum speed: 160 km/h (100 mph) Power: 746 kW (1,000 hp) Build year: 1981 - 1987 Maker: BREL Re-build year: 2006 - 2018 Quantity produced: 72 Quantity offered: Quantity Gauge: 1,435 mm (4'8.5") Car length: 19,830 mm (65'3⁄4") Width: 2,820 mm (9'3") Height: 3,700 mm (12'1 5/8") Overall weight: 137.3 tonnes Train brakes: Air Brake manufacturer: Westinghouse Coupler type: Tightlock Voltage system: 25 kV 50 Hz AC Overhead Power collection: Pantograph Passenger accommodation: Mixed
